ABSTRACT

Perforation complicates endoscopic sphincterotomy (EST) in approximately 1% of cases. However, pneunomediastinum and/or subcutaneous emphysema due to duodenal perforation after EST have rarely been reported. The management strategy of this awkward complication of EST remains controversial. Conservative treatment with antibiotics and nasogastric and/or biliary drainage has been reported to be adequate, but some authors still advocate early surgery for all perforations. Therefore, it seems necessary to accumulate more data in order to set up a management algorithm in these cases. Recently, we experienced a case of pneumoretroperitoneum, pneumomediastinum, and subcutaneous emphysema developed after EST and stone removal in which recovery was achieved with conservative treatment in a 87-year-old woman with previous Billroth II partial gastrectomy. We herein report this rare complication of EST and a management algorithm is suggested based on a literature review.

ABSTRACT

Hemorrhagic fever with renal syndrome is characterized clinically by the triad of fever, hemorrhage and renal failure. The hemorrhage in hemorrhagic fever with renal syndrome(HFRS) varies from transient petechial lesions to fulminant and massive bleeding. The latter can be an important cause of death in HFRS. We here report a case of massive perirenal hematoma in a patient with HFRS. A 17-year-old male was admited to our hospital presenting with fever, sore throat, nausea and oliuria. Computed tomography was performed at the 2nd day of hospitalization due to abruptly developing right flank pain and anemia and showed perirenal hematoma on the right kidney. He was diagnosed as HFRS and treated with hemodialysis, fluid infusion, and transfusion. There was no evidence of further blood loss at the 7th day of hospitalization. After conservative treatment, he recovered from HFRS.

ABSTRACT

BACKGROUND AND OBJECTIVES: Syncope is defined as a sudden temporary loss of consciousness associated with a loss of postural tone with spontaneous recovery. It is a common clinical problem with complex and heterogeneous etiologies, but vasovagal syncope is the main cause of unexplained syncope. Bradycardia and hypotension by transient dysfunction of cardiac autonomic nervous system have been cited as the main pathophysiology of the vasovagal syncope. Therefore, we studied whether analysis of heart rate variability (HRV) by 24-hour ambulatory ECG monitoring would reflect autonomic imbalance between cardiac sympathetic and vagal efferent activity in the patients of vasovagal syncope. MATERIALS AND METHOD: 45 patients (male=2, female=3, mean age=2.214 years) with syncope were enrolled, and divided into 2 subgroups according to the results of head-up tilt test: head-up tilt test positive (group S1) and negative (group S0). A sex-matched control group consisted of 9 healthy volunteers (male=, female=, mean age=16 years, Group C). The 24-hour ambulatory ECG monitoring was performed in all groups, and R-R intervals were analyzed by time- and frequency-domain methods. The time-domain measurements of HRV were mean NN(mean of all coupling intervals between normal beat), ASDNN(mean of the standard deviations of all normal R-R intervals for 5-minute segments of the entire recording), SDNN(standard deviation of all normal R-R intervals over 24 hours), SDANN(standard deviation of average R-R intervals in all 5 minutes segments of the entire recording), rMSSD(square root of the mean squared differences of successive R-R interval) and pNN50(percent of differences between adjacent normal R-R intervals more than 50ms during 24 hours), and frequency-domain measurements were low frequency (LF), high frequency (HF) components and LF/HF ratio. RESULTS: The LF/HF ratio was significantly higher in syncope patients with positive results of head-up tilt test and syncope patients with negative results than in control (p<0.05). The LF, HF, mean NN, ASDNN, SDNN, SDANN, rMSSD, and pNN50 were not significantly different among these three groups. CONCLUSION: These results suggest that the cardiac autonomic nervous system in patients with vasovagal syncope has sympathetic-activated balanced without changes of total power of both sympathetic and parasympathetic components.
